Ina short documentary film was released along with another fundraising campaign. The documentary focused on the bar owners, community activists, and patrons in three cities New York, NY Mobile, AL and Washington, DC and their struggles during the pandemic, their hopes for the future, and the impact on their communities. The Lesbian Bar Project believes what makes a bar uniquely Lesbian is its prioritization of creating space for people of marginalized genders including women regardless if they are cis or transnon-binary folks, and trans men.
